Configuring
OSPF Globally
Using the CLI

To globally configure OSPF using the CLI, enter the following
command in Configure mode:

Cajun> (configure)# router ospf

Refer to the Cajun™ P550™/P880/P882 Command Line Interface
Reference Guide for Version 5.0
for details about this command.

Table 11-1. OSPF Global Configuration Dialog Box Parameters

Parameter

Allows you to...

OSPF

Select to enable or disable OSPF globally on your switch.

Router ID

Specify the Router ID on the switch. The router ID is a
32-bit number assigned to each router running OSPF.
This number uniquely identifies the router within an
Autonomous System. If 0.0.0.0 is used, the router uses
the IP address of an interface.

AS Border
Router

Enable or disable the switch to be an Autonomous
System Border Router (ASBR).

SPF Hold
Time

Specify the minimum number of seconds between SPF
runs.

SPF Suspend

Specify the number of nodes to process SPF runs before
suspending.

Auto-
Creation of
Virtual Links

Enable or disable the function of automating the
creation of virtual circuits based on network topology.

Maximum
Number of
Paths

Configure the maximum number of paths used when
running SPF.

Local Ext
Type

Specify whether imported local routes are advertised in
OSPF with type 1 (internal) or type 2 (external) metrics.

RIP Ext Type

Specify whether imported RIP routes are advertised in
OSPF with type 1 (internal) or type 2 (external) metrics.

Static Ext
Type

Specify whether imported high preference routes are
advertised in OSPF with type 1 (internal) or type 2
(external) metrics.

Static Low
Ext Type

Specify whether imported low preference routes are
advertised in OSPF with type 1 (internal) or type 2
(external) metrics.
